Depending on the nature of your project, you and your team may need different types and levels of support.
NFC understands this, and we offer a variety of services to help you on your project journey.
Application Development
Good software design is critical to ensure that your application works in the way you have envisioned. NFC can help you to translate your software requirements into effective solutions with proper software design implementations, so you can perform your tests with peace of mind, and demonstrate to your stakeholders with confidence. Should you wish to include the source code as part of the deliverable, you can be assured that it will be well documented and easy to maintain.
NI LabVIEW™ is NFC’s preferred software development platform. With our extensive experience in creating LabVIEW solutions, and our Certified LabVIEW Architect (CLA) qualification, we meet the stringent standards set by National Instruments in developing high quality solutions for our customers. NFC also has a Certified Professional Instructor (CPI) onboard, and we can create a custom training content as part of your software solution package.
Our applications span across embedded measurements, photonics, data acquisition, SCADA and more. Check out some of our case studies here!
Onsite Consultation
NFC is also able to provide onsite consultation at a daily rate. This is useful when your LabVIEW-based systems do not work and you need a specialist to assist in troubleshooting on the spot. Alternatively, your staff may require coaching in reading and getting familiarized with LabVIEW source code. Onsite consultation offers your team a flexible approach in fulfilling such specific needs.
Code Review and Migration
Do you have LabVIEW-based systems that are using up too much memory, or slowing down your computer? With NFC’s experience in architecting software, we can help review your code, and show you ways to make your code more efficient, so that your engineers can implement those changes. Alternatively, depending on the scale, NFC is also able to provide this refactoring service.
Users with legacy code handed down may also face issues when they need to upgrade their LabVIEW software to the latest versions, as certain components may no longer work in the way they used to. NFC can assist you in migrating your system to the current LabVIEW version, and suggest / implement workarounds for those obsolete components.
Have a look here to see how we helped our clients in this area!